Central America Moves on
Migration Issues
The 15th Extraordinary Meeting
of the Central American
Commission of Migration
Directors held in Honduras moved
towards a common agenda that
will allow the countries of the
area to have similar tools of
territorial deployment.
The authorities of the regional
countries of Mexico and the
Dominican Republic analyzed the
protection measures to
strengthen cooperation in this
area.
They also debated the future
validity of a single visa system
between Honduras, Nicaragua, El
Salvador and Guatemala, which
group is called CA-4.
The Honduran director of
migration German Espinal assured
that joint initiatives were
discussed at the event to
protect the people without
identification papers.
"We want to guarantee safe
return and fair treatment of
human rights of citizens
arrested in other countries,"
affirmed Espinal.
The meeting also examined the
advances regarding the documents
necessary for the implementation
of the single visa CA-4 soon.
